Four Star Hotels in Nyaribari Chache
Nyaribari Chache
Select CheckIn Date
Select CheckOut Date
You are booking hotel for more than 30 days
Off Hospital Road, opp Police HQ
Nyaribari Chache
Nyaribari Chache
Kitutu Chache South
Kitutu Chache South